Output 3cbabe8444ca9c0dfbfe42f86d2cb4571c83f90c20a5a24df741ef056c85ba8b:4

value
25100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c44c3c49d5aac1af0bbccd1557d11611e6505b3 OP_EQUAL
address
3BZVH7nkogvnvXLEt52we5MJxyeZ73SpdE
transaction
3cbabe8444ca9c0dfbfe42f86d2cb4571c83f90c20a5a24df741ef056c85ba8b
confirmations
425554
spent
true